Residual nilpotence and ordering in one-relator groups and knot groups

Abstract

Let G=<x,tw>G=< x,t\mid w> be a one-relator group, where ww is a word in x,tx,t. If ww is a product of conjugates of xx then, associated with ww, there is a polynomial Aw(X)A_w(X) over the integers, which in the case when GG is a knot group, is the Alexander polynomial of the knot. We prove, subject to certain restrictions on ww, that if all roots of Aw(X)A_w(X) are real and positive then GG is bi-orderable, and that if GG is bi-orderable then at least one root is real and positive. This sheds light on the bi-orderability of certain knot groups and on a question of Clay and Rolfsen. One of the results relies on an extension of work of G. Baumslag on adjunction of roots to groups, and this may have independent interest.
